[FFmpeg-user] How to calculate the real (!) average variable video bitrate of a whole video with ffmpeg?

2018-11-03 Thread Ben
Assume I have a AVI, MP4 or MKV video which is encoded with a variable video bitrate. Now I want to findout the average video bitrate across the WHOLE (!) video. Now when I drag the video onto such tools like MediaInfo they show only the average video bitrate of the first 5 or 20 seconds or so.
